The Evolution of the Core Bike

The core bike has evolved significantly over time, driven by technological advancements, changing riding styles, and the increasing demands of cyclists. Early bicycles were primarily utilitarian, designed for transportation and practicality. However, as cycling gained popularity, different disciplines emerged, leading to the development of specialized bikes tailored to specific purposes.

The evolution of the road core bike, for example, has seen a shift from heavy steel frames to lightweight aluminum and carbon fiber designs. Aerodynamics have become increasingly important, with manufacturers incorporating features like integrated cabling, streamlined tube shapes, and optimized frame geometries. Similarly, mountain bike technology has advanced rapidly, with the introduction of suspension systems, disc brakes, and wider tires, enabling riders to tackle increasingly challenging trails.

Variations of the Core Bike: Exploring Different Disciplines

The concept of the core bike extends across various cycling disciplines, each with its unique characteristics and intended use. Here are a few examples:

Road Core Bike

As previously mentioned, the road core bike prioritizes speed and efficiency on paved surfaces. Key features include a lightweight frame, drop handlebars for aerodynamic positioning, and narrow tires for low rolling resistance. These bikes are designed for long-distance riding, racing, and general fitness training on roads and paved paths.

Mountain Core Bike

The mountain core bike is built for off-road adventures, emphasizing durability, suspension, and traction. Key features include a sturdy frame, front or full suspension, wide knobby tires, and powerful brakes. These bikes are designed to handle rough terrain, steep climbs, and technical descents.

Hybrid Core Bike

The hybrid core bike is a versatile option that combines features of both road and mountain bikes. It typically has a comfortable upright riding position, flat handlebars, and moderately wide tires. Hybrid bikes are well-suited for commuting, recreational riding, and exploring a variety of surfaces, from paved roads to gravel paths.

Gravel Core Bike

The gravel core bike is designed for riding on unpaved roads and trails, offering a balance of speed, comfort, and durability. Key features include a lightweight frame, drop handlebars, wider tires with tread, and disc brakes. These bikes are ideal for exploring gravel roads, forest trails, and other mixed-terrain environments.

BMX Core Bike

The BMX (Bicycle Moto Cross) core bike is a specialized bike designed for racing and performing tricks. It has a small, sturdy frame, single-speed drivetrain, and durable components. BMX bikes are used for racing on dirt tracks, performing tricks in skateparks, and freestyle riding.

Key Considerations When Choosing a Core Bike

Selecting the right core bike depends on several factors, including your riding style, intended use, budget, and personal preferences. Here are some key considerations to keep in mind:

  • Riding Style: Consider the type of riding you plan to do most often. Are you primarily interested in road riding, mountain biking, commuting, or a combination of activities?
  • Intended Use: Think about the specific purposes for which you’ll be using the bike. Will you be using it for commuting, fitness training, racing, or recreational riding?
  • Budget: Determine your budget and look for bikes that offer the best value for your money. Remember that quality components and a well-designed frame can make a significant difference in performance and durability.
  • Frame Material: Choose a frame material that suits your needs and budget. Aluminum frames are lightweight and affordable, while carbon fiber frames offer superior stiffness and vibration damping.
  • Components: Pay attention to the quality of the components, such as the drivetrain, brakes, and wheels. Higher-quality components will typically provide better performance, durability, and reliability.
  • Fit: Ensure that the bike fits you properly. A bike that is too large or too small can be uncomfortable and inefficient to ride. Consider getting a professional bike fit to ensure optimal comfort and performance.

Maintaining Your Core Bike

Proper maintenance is essential for keeping your core bike in good working condition and ensuring its longevity. Regular maintenance tasks include:

  • Cleaning: Clean your bike regularly to remove dirt, grime, and debris.
  • Lubrication: Lubricate the chain, derailleurs, and other moving parts to ensure smooth operation.
  • Tire Inflation: Maintain proper tire pressure to optimize rolling resistance and prevent flats.
  • Brake Adjustment: Adjust the brakes regularly to ensure optimal stopping power.
  • Component Inspection: Inspect the components regularly for wear and tear. Replace worn parts as needed.
